Output acaf2680a742d542a4d32e6660801a8dc153c82d9f8ea614f89f47710199b632:3

value
177069762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 756f2c509971311e924fbceb73b618b92f00d614 OP_EQUAL
address
MJc6UKLwqZ9DynjsTVFQFD5VW5EVKGM53b
transaction
acaf2680a742d542a4d32e6660801a8dc153c82d9f8ea614f89f47710199b632
spent
true